Podcast Description
Rev. Munther Isaac hosts Palestinian theologians, clergy, and leaders for conversations that highlight and empower the voice of Palestinian Christians. Conversations range from discussing the life of Palestinian Christians under occupation, and their perspectives and theological reflections about the Palestine question.

Rev. Munther Isaac is joined by Daniel Bannoura and Tony Deik to discuss a problematic recent article published at The Gospel Coalition. The article titled ”Beyond Slogans: A Christian Perspective on Gaza” peddles in distortions and harmful rhetoric that obfuscates the situation in Palestine and the experience of Palestinian Christians.
